What is our TEKS?

TEKS 8.3A:

The student will generalize that the ratio of corresponding sides of similar shapes are proportional, including a shape and its dilation.

  • Dilation means that the size of the figure will change. The figure will get LARGER or SMALLER.

  • Dilations produce SIMILAR FIGURES - meaning same shape but different size.

Corresponding Sides:

When you have figures that are enlarged or shrunk, you can find the scale factor by comparing corresponding sides.
